For one, you conveniently ignore the fact that only the Natanz facility can be used to enrich uranium until 2031. For another, you ignore the fact that level of enrichment cannot exceed 3.67%. And you ignore that the total amount of enriched uranium cannot exceed 300 kg. Not to mention the total number of centrifuges is capped, regardless of the technology.

The teeth to the agreement is that if Iran violates their part, the sanctions snap back to where they were before the agreement. If the agreement is broken, then that doesn't happen. It took years to get all of the countries involved to put sanctions into place. Breaking the agreement means that the world is worse off than they were before the agreement was put into place.
